Established in 1956, The University of South Florida is located in the city of Florida, USA. The university is widespread across 1562 acres. Every year, The University of South Florida enrolls around 5852 international students having a significant male-to-female ratio of 1:1.47, which clearly states the popularity of the university among female students. The university’s departments offer courses around the stream of Engineering, Business & Management Studies, IT & Software, Science, Medicine & Health Sciences and popular majors, such as Computer Science, Finance, General Medicine, Electrical Engineering, Chemical Engineering, etc., at the UG and PG level. There are a total of 3 campuses of The University of South Florida, where per student to faculty ratio lies at 1:22.

- University offers on campus housing facilities to all students including undergraduate and postgraduate
- University offers three types of housing: Traditional (Double Bedroom with Shared Bathroom for every 3-4 rooms), Suite (Double Bedrooms with Shared Bathroom for every 1-2 rooms) and Apartment Style Housing (Four Private Bedrooms and Two Bathrooms)
- University offers 25+ dining locations on campus including three all-you-care-to-eat dining halls that cater to every diet including Vegan, Vegetarian, Gluten-Free, Kosher and Halal options

- The residence type includes studio apartments, 4 bedroom apartments, 3 bedroom apartments, 2 bedroom apartments, and single bedroom apartments
- The average rent is 500 to 900 USD/month
- The student apartments are fully furnished with all the basic amenities such as electricity, water, gas, modular kitchen, laundry, parking space, and unlimited internet access
- All the apartments have the lease. The duration differs from 5 to 12months based on the apartment type
